Common StartAlerter.exe Errors on Windows

Dealing with StartAlerter.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with StartAlerter.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.

  • StartAlerter.exe File Not Executing: This alert shows up when the system cannot initiate the executable file. Possible causes could include file corruption, inappropriate file permissions, or a lack of necessary system resources.
  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This warning is shown when the application fails to start as it should, typically caused by an inconsistency between the 32-bit and 64-bit versions of the application and the Windows operating system.
  • StartAlerter.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error arises when Windows cannot run StartAlerter.exe due to the file being corrupted, or because the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
  • StartAlerter.exe Application Error: This error message indicates a problem encountered by the executable application during its execution. This could be due to software bugs, corrupted files, or conflicts with other programs.
  • Application Not Found: This error can arise when the StartAlerter.exe file has been moved, deleted, or is not properly associated with the program it belongs to.

How to perform a repair install of Windows. A repair installation resets all Windows system files.

Step 1: Create a Windows 10 Installation Media

Step 1: Create a Windows 10 Installation Media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Microsoft website and download the Windows 10 Media Creation Tool.

  2. Run the tool and select Create installation media for another PC.

  3. Follow the prompts to create a bootable USB drive or ISO file.

Step 2: Start the Repair Install

Step 2: Start the Repair Install Thumbnail
  1. Insert the Windows 10 installation media you created into your PC and run setup.exe.

  2. Follow the prompts until you get to the Ready to install screen.

Step 3: Choose the Right Install Option

Step 3: Choose the Right Install Option Thumbnail
  1. On the Ready to install screen, make sure Keep personal files and apps is selected.

  2. Click Install to start the repair install.

Step 4: Complete the Installation

Step 4: Complete the Installation Thumbnail
  1. Your computer will restart several times during the installation. Make sure not to turn off your computer during this process.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the installation, check if the StartAlerter.exe problem persists.
